There is a significant gap in the cost of living between these two cities. Clinton is 24.8% cheaper than Lake Junaluska. With a cost index of 71 vs 94, the difference would have a meaningful impact on a household's monthly budget. Someone relocating from Clinton to Lake Junaluska should plan for substantially higher expenses across most categories.

On the housing front, median rent in Clinton is $754/month compared to $1,135/month in Lake Junaluska — a 34% difference. Home values follow the same pattern: Clinton is more affordable at $185,600 median vs $329,600.

Median household income in Clinton is $42,344 compared to $82,115 in Lake Junaluska (-48.4%). While Lake Junaluska is more expensive, its higher salaries more than compensate — residents there may actually end up with more disposable income. Looking at affordability, residents of Clinton spend roughly 21.4% of their income on rent, more than the 16.6% in Lake Junaluska.
